Additional file 3: Supplementary materials. Thermal properties database for samples of the Upper Rhine Graben in the dry state at ambient temperature (black), water-saturated state at ambient temperature (blue), dry state at high temperature (red). Samples are in stratigraphical order. Data include lithology, measured porosity, measuring temperature, thermal conductivity and associated standard deviation, thermal diffusivity and associated standard deviation, calculated volumetric heat capacity and associated standard deviation, effect of water saturation and slope of the trendline of thermal conductivity as a function of temperature (Fig. 8).
